Life Along the Tracks: The Rise of Railroad Settlements

The 19th and early 20th centuries experienced an unprecedented growth of railway networks across continents. To facilitate this development, railroad companies established settlements along these routes. These were frequently quickly prepared and built, meant to be practical and practical rather than picturesque. They worked as functional hubs, housing upkeep backyards, service center, and marshalling areas. The population of these settlements was largely composed of railroad workers-- track layers, mechanics, engineers, and their families-- together with merchants and provider who accommodated their requirements.

Life in railroad settlements provided an unique set of difficulties and scenarios. Real estate was often basic and company-owned, regularly located in close distance to rail backyards and industrial activities. Access to clean water and sanitation could be restricted, and ecological policies were often non-existent or inadequately imposed throughout the duration of their fast growth. The primary industry, railroading, itself was naturally hazardous, exposing workers to a variety of potentially carcinogenic compounds. These settlements, for that reason, became microcosms of early industrial life, embodying both its opportunities and its intrinsic risks.

Unloading the Potential Culprits: Environmental and Occupational Exposures

To comprehend why railroad settlements might be associated with a higher threat of stomach cancer, it's crucial to examine the typical direct exposures present in these environments. Numerous aspects have actually been determined as prospective factors, acting individually or in mix:

  • Water Contamination: Early railroad settlements frequently had problem with access to clean water sources. Industrial activities, consisting of rail backyard operations and garbage disposal, could result in contamination of local water products. Notably, arsenic, a known carcinogen, was traditionally utilized in wood conservation for railway ties and could seep into the soil and groundwater. Other prospective contaminants could consist of heavy metals and commercial solvents used in repair and maintenance processes.
  • Asbestos Exposure: Asbestos was commonly utilized in railroad building and construction and maintenance, discovering applications in insulation for engines and railcars, brake linings, and structure materials in workshops and housing. Railroad workers and residents could be exposed to asbestos fibers through the air, especially throughout repairs, demolition, and general wear and tear of asbestos-containing products. Asbestos exposure is a reputable threat aspect for different cancers, consisting of mesothelioma cancer and lung cancer; while its direct link to stand cancer is less direct, some research studies suggest a prospective association.
  • Creosote and Wood Preservatives: Creosote, a coal tar derivative, was heavily used to treat wooden railway ties to prevent rot and insect infestation. Creosote contains polycyclic aromatic hydrocarbons (PAHs), numerous of which are known carcinogens. Workers managing treated ties, along with citizens living near rail lawns or tie treatment centers, could be exposed to creosote through skin contact, inhalation, and potentially through polluted soil and water.
  • Diesel Exhaust and Industrial Emissions: Railroad operations include the use of diesel locomotives and various industrial procedures that create air contamination. Diesel exhaust is an intricate mix containing particulate matter and carcinogenic chemicals. Locals of railroad settlements, especially those living near rail yards, could experience chronic exposure to diesel exhaust and other commercial emissions, possibly increasing their cancer danger gradually.
  • Occupational Exposures: Beyond specific substances, the nature of railroad work itself included a physically requiring and typically hazardous environment. Workers were exposed to dust, fumes, noise, and ergonomic stress factors. Particular tasks, such as engine repair work, track maintenance, and working with dealt with wood, could involve direct exposure to carcinogens.
  • Socioeconomic Factors: Historically, railroad settlements typically represented lower socioeconomic brackets with limited access to healthcare, nutritious food, and public health resources. These socioeconomic disparities can exacerbate health threats and affect cancer outcomes. Postponed medical diagnosis and treatment, coupled with possibly poorer diet plans and living conditions, might add to a greater incidence of stomach cancer.
  • Dietary Factors: While less directly connected to the railroad environment itself, dietary practices common in some working-class communities during the appropriate periods might have contributed. Diet plans high in salt-preserved and smoked foods, and low in fresh vegetables and fruits (due to accessibility and expense) have been connected with increased stomach cancer danger. This dietary pattern, while not unique to railroad settlements, could have been more typical in these neighborhoods due to historical and socioeconomic factors.
